What i-FORCE MAX Means for Daily Driving
Toyota’s i-FORCE MAX pairs a turbocharged 2.4L gasoline engine with an electric motor for strong low-end shove and consistently smooth acceleration. That matters on crowded Calera thoroughfares where a short merge window can pop up fast. Up to 326 horsepower and 465 lb.-ft. of torque help Tacoma jump off the line and carry speed without hunting for gears, while the hybrid system’s tuning keeps noise and vibration pleasantly subdued in traffic.
The result is a truck that feels “light on its feet” in suburban driving yet utterly planted at highway speeds. If your day takes you from a morning run to the distribution center to an afternoon pickup across town, the hybrid’s broad torque curve keeps the truck relaxed and responsive, even loaded with gear.
Ride, Handling, and Control You Can Feel
The 2026 Tacoma uses purpose-built suspension options across trims, so you can choose the feel that best matches your life. TRD Sport’s tuning sharpens reflexes on paved routes, while TRD Off-Road brings Bilstein® monotube shocks with piggyback reservoirs for better heat management and control when the going gets rough. Limited introduces Adaptive Variable Suspension (AVS) for a composed, premium ride on broken pavement and long stretches of highway between Calera and Birmingham.
What sets Tacoma apart is how those systems all play well with off-road assist features. Available Crawl Control (CRAWL) and the Stabilizer Disconnect Mechanism (SDM) give you grace under pressure on loose gravel roads, worksite access trails, and slick boat ramps. Even if you are not a hardcore overlander, those features translate to smoother, safer, and more predictable truck behavior around town and beyond.
Visibility and Tech That Simplify the Day
Parking lots around local shopping centers are easier to navigate with clear camera views and bright displays. The available 14-in. Audio Multimedia Display and 12.3-in. digital gauge cluster keep critical information exactly where you expect it—navigation cues, safety alerts, and vehicle data are big, crisp, and easy to read. When backing a trailer into a tight driveway, the available Trailer Backup Guide with Straight Path Assist and integrated brake controller help remove the guesswork.
For those quick stops at a client’s jobsite, the available 2400W power supply is a game-changer. Charge batteries, run light tools, or power camp gear for an impromptu evening at Limestone Park. It is plug-and-play capability right from the bed, no generator needed.

Why Tacoma’s Safety Stack Feels Built for Local Roads
Toyota Safety Sense™ 3.0 is standard, and it shows its value on the daily. Full-Speed Range Dynamic Radar Cruise Control, Lane Tracing Assist, and Pre-Collision System with Pedestrian Detection all ease the mental load of driving in heavy traffic. Add Blind Spot Monitor with Rear Cross-Traffic Alert, and you have a confidence-inspiring assistant for busier shopping areas and school pickup lines.
Off the beaten path, the available 3D Multi-Terrain Monitor displays underbody and side views so you can place a tire precisely while turning off county roads to a trailhead or navigating deeply rutted driveways. It is one of those truck features you never knew you needed until the first time it saves a bumper or a rim.
